Shri Ganesh Purana Katha Pujya Swami ji’s discourse on Ganesha Purana is themed around the life-tales of Lord Ganesha, the son of Lord Shiva and Goddess Parvati. The discourse begins with an account of Lord Ganesha’s birth and then proceeds to detail the events leading to the Lord acquiring an elephant head. Swami ji also describes the ascent of the Lord to become the God of beginnings for all auspicious activities. The two modes of worship, namely meditation and idol worship, are also elucidated vividly during this discourse. About Shri Ganesh Purana Ganesha Purana is a famous upapurana (minor Purana) of Hinduism that relates to the philosophy and teachings of Lord Ganesha. Written in Sanskrit, this scripture presents Lord Ganesha as a union of Saguna (with attributes) and Nirguna (without attributes). Ganesha Purana also embodies a section on Ganesha Geeta which is modeled on Shrimad Bhagwat Geeta but considers Lord Ganesha as the highest power. It has details on the different avatars (incarnations) of the Lord, hence is considered the ultimate scripture by worshippers of Lord Ganesha.
